  1. Click ‘Get Form’ to open the yard permit grand terrace in the editor.
  2. Begin by entering your name in the 'NAME OF APPLICANT' field. This identifies you as the person responsible for the sale.
  3. Fill in the 'LOCATION OF SALE' section with your street address and apartment number, if applicable. This is crucial for permit validation.
  4. Specify the sale dates by filling in the 'FROM DATE' and 'TO DATE' fields. Remember, sales can only last up to three consecutive days.
  5. Ensure you sign in the 'AUTHORIZED SIGNATURE' section to validate your application. This confirms your agreement to adhere to municipal regulations.

The Ontario Building Code was recently changed to allow for sheds up to 160 square feet to be built WITHOUT a building permit. Any structure larger than 160 square feet requires a building permit.
If your backyard shed, garden shed, or storage shed is less than 160 square feet (or 15 square meters) you can construct it WITHOUT a building permit. A Building permit is required for any shed over 160 square feet. Building permits are always required for accessory structures that contain plumbing.

The quick and simple answer is: you usually dont need a permit if the shed is 120 square feet or less. In California, most jurisdictions have adopted the 120 square foot rule. If your shed area is larger than 120 square feet, it needs a building permit.
